Key Ingredients
- 6 hard-boiled eggs
- 3 tablespoons mayonnaise
- 1 teaspoon mustard
- 1 teaspoon vinegar
- Salt to taste
- Pepper to taste
- Paprika for garnish
If you’re looking to mix things up, Greek yogurt can be a lighter substitute for mayonnaise, and you can swap out mustard for a flavored variety to give your dish a unique twist.
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Slice the hard-boiled eggs in half and carefully take out the yolks.
- In a mixing bowl, combine the egg yolks, mayonnaise, mustard, vinegar, salt, and pepper until the mixture is smooth and creamy.
- Return the yolk mixture back into the egg white halves by spooning or piping it in for an elegant finish.
- Use paprika to sprinkle on top for a dash of color and flavor.
- Chill in the refrigerator before serving. Enjoy your delightful treat!

Storage & Reheating
To keep your deviled eggs fresh, store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to two days. If you want to freeze them, it’s best to freeze the egg whites and yolk mixture separately, as the texture can change once thawed. Just remember to thaw them in the fridge and enjoy within a day after that!
Helpful Cooking Tips
- For perfectly hard-boiled eggs, let them sit in hot water for 10-12 minutes after boiling before placing them in cold water to cool.
- If you want a little kick, add a dash of hot sauce or sprinkle with cayenne pepper instead of paprika.
- If you’re short on time, pre-packaged hard-boiled eggs are a great timesaver!

Your Questions Answered
How do I make sure my hard-boiled eggs are easy to peel?
Using eggs that are a few days old rather than fresh ones can help them peel more easily. Also, try cooling them quickly in ice water.
Can I make deviled eggs in advance?
Yes! You can prepare the filling a day ahead and fill the egg whites just before serving for the best texture.
What can I add to the filling for extra flavor?
Consider adding ingredients like garlic powder, chopped herbs, or even shredded cheese to bring new dimensions to your filling.
